### Snapshot Testing Overview

Veldora UI components are verified with snapshot tests under the Glimmerframe harness. Snapshots are stored in-repo and reviewed on every change; baselines cannot be updated without approval from two maintainers. No user data appears in fixtures. If you identify a snapshot that captures sensitive rendering state, report it immediately to the review desk.

escalation mailbox, hadug-bajog: sormir@norvalabs.internal

**Alert: tailfox CLI — tail session failures**

The tailfox CLI is failing to open tail sessions against the Greymarsh log brokers. Error rate above 30% for 15 minutes. Release impact: deploy verification relies on live tails, so holds may be needed. Workaround: use the batch-pull mode until sessions recover. Triage steps and current broker status are tracked on the page below.

dashboard of bajef-bageg = https://confluence.lumiclabs.internal/browse/browse/pages/display/93ae

## Deployment

Ternhop applies schema migrations with zero downtime using an expand-and-contract flow: new columns ship first, code follows, old columns drop a release later. The release manager triggers each phase manually; never combine phases in one deploy. The migration runner must be started with the configuration below.

config for kafof-bawef:
holath:
  log_level: debug
  metrics_host: metrics.holath.qorvelsys.internal
  pin: 2191
  pool_size: 32